TIG welding systems deliver precision, low-spatter welds for stainless steel, aluminum, and exotic alloys using AC/DC and pulsed modes. Modern units support foot or fingertip control and advanced pulse programming to tame heat input and produce clean, repeatable welds on thin sections and critical joints. In Canada the market favors inverter-based compact power sources for portability and energy efficiency, digital and IoT-enabled controls for traceability, and orbital TIG solutions for consistent pipe welding in industrial and fabrication settings. Buyers from hobbyists and small shops to heavy fabricators choose TIG for its superior arc control, minimal cleanup, and better metallurgical results. Practical consumer preferences in Canada also emphasize service network coverage, CSA-compliant components, ease of use in cold shop environments, and flexible duty cycles for mixed-production workloads.

Miller Dynasty 210

Miller

The Miller Dynasty 210 is widely regarded as best-in-class for TIG welding because its advanced AC/DC arc control, pulse functions, and memory settings deliver exceptional arc stability and aluminum performance. It outpaces competitors on fine-tuneability and repeatability, making it the choice for fabricators who prioritize precision even though it carries a premium price compared with value-oriented units. Versus multi-process machines like the ESAB Rebel EMP 215ic or compact portables like the Miller Maxstar 161, the Dynasty 210 is the TIG-specialist option for shops that need top-tier TIG results.

Lincoln Electric Square Wave TIG 200

Lincoln Electric

The Lincoln Electric Square Wave TIG 200 is a market-leading value-oriented AC/DC TIG unit that balances strong aluminum and steel performance with approachable controls and good duty cycle for its class. It provides many of the core TIG features of higher-end machines such as the Dynasty 210 but at a lower acquisition cost, making it the go-to for users who want near-professional TIG capability without the highest price. Compared with versatile multi-process machines like the ESAB Rebel EMP 215ic, the Square Wave 200 focuses on delivering excellent TIG performance rather than process flexibility.

ESAB Rebel EMP 215ic

ESAB

The ESAB Rebel EMP 215ic is the most versatile option on the list, combining TIG, MIG and Stick in one inverter platform and offering strong value for shops that need multi-process capability rather than a TIG-only workhorse. Its financial advantage is lower total equipment cost for multiple processes, though its TIG output typically lacks some of the arc finesse and specialized controls found on dedicated TIG systems like the Dynasty 210 or Fronius TransTig 210. For users who must cover a wide range of welding tasks, the Rebel EMP 215ic delivers practical technical flexibility unmatched by single-process machines.

Fronius TransTig 210

Fronius

The Fronius TransTig 210 represents European precision in TIG welding, with especially refined AC wave shaping and control that excel on aluminum and thin materials where arc stability and heat control matter most. It competes directly with the Miller Dynasty 210 on technical capability but often targets shops that prioritize the finest AC balance and digital control, sometimes at a higher price point. Compared to more budget-friendly or multi-process units, the TransTig 210’s advantage is its best-in-class aluminum performance and professional-level process control.

Miller Maxstar 161 STL

Miller

The Miller Maxstar 161 STL is best-in-class for portability and field TIG work, offering a lightweight, compact DC inverter that delivers a robust arc for steel and stainless at a lower cost than full-featured AC/DC bench machines. Its key technical and financial advantage is portability and simplicity—ideal for service techs—though it lacks AC capability for aluminum welding that machines like the Dynasty 210 or Square Wave 200 provide. For users who need a dependable, budget-friendly TIG welder for ferrous metals and frequent travel, the Maxstar 161 STL is a top practical choice.

Why TIG Works: Evidence and Practical Benefits

Scientific and technical studies in welding and materials engineering show that TIG welding offers precise heat control, stable arcs, and low contamination when using a non-consumable tungsten electrode and inert shielding gas. Research demonstrates that pulsed TIG and AC waveform control reduce heat affected zone size, lower distortion, and improve mechanical properties and joint fatigue life on thin and high-alloy metals. Inverter-based power supplies and digital control schemes enhance arc stability and repeatability, which is especially important for production and traceability in regulated industries.

Pulsed TIG reduces average heat input, shrinking the heat affected zone and minimizing warping on thin materials.

AC balance and frequency control improve aluminum cleaning action and weld bead profile, supported by metallurgical testing.

Inverter technology produces smoother arc characteristics and higher energy efficiency compared with older transformer designs.

Orbital TIG systems provide uniform circumferential welds with documented improvements in repeatability for pipe and tubing applications.

Digital/IoT-enabled controls enable process logging and parameter recall, which helps with quality assurance and regulatory compliance.
